Latin Name: Paeonia 'Julia Rose'

Height: 30 - 36 inches

Spread: 36 - 42 inches

Sunlight: Full Sun; Part Sun; Part Shade

Bloom Time: May to June

Hardiness Zone: 4-9

Description:

Julia Rose Tree Peony is a cross between the tree peony and garden peony. Many people enjoy these crosses, known as Itoh Peonies, for their large blooms and sturdy stems. Even with the weight of the blooms, it will seldom require staking. The Julia Rose features reddish-purple tones, lightening to apricot and pale yellow as they age, double blooms averaging 8 inches wide. Like the garden peony, this Itoh variety will die back to the ground after frost. An old-fashioned favorite, peony blooms are excellent for use as a cut flower. When bringing them into the house, be sure to cleanse the ants from the bloom, as ants benefit from the nectar secreted by peonies. Cut the blooms when the buds are close to opening, as it is easier to shake or wipe the ants off compared to after the bud starts to open. Peonies will continue to open even after they are cut. 

Attracts: Bees

Other Names: Intersectional Peony; Itoh Peony
